> > NLA_POLICY_VALIDATE_FN(), not sure why the types for this
> > validation_type are limited.. Johannes, just an abundance of caution?  
> 
> So let me see if I got this right - you're saying you'd like to use
> NLA_POLICY_VALIDATE_FN() for an NLA_U32, to validate against the _LANES
> being 1, 2, 4 or 8?
> 
> First of all, you _can_, no? I mean, it's limited by
> 
> #define NLA_ENSURE_NO_VALIDATION_PTR(tp)                \
>         (__NLA_ENSURE(tp != NLA_BITFIELD32 &&           \
>                       tp != NLA_REJECT &&               \
>                       tp != NLA_NESTED &&               \
>                       tp != NLA_NESTED_ARRAY) + tp)
> 
> and the reason is sort of encoded in that - the types listed here
> already use the pointer *regardless of the validation_type*, so you
> can't have a pointer to the function in the same union.
